Here are some friendly reminders regarding general rules, tips and expectations to help you become accustomed to your “home away from home”!

Noise:

In order to avoid disturbing the others, please use headphones when listening to music, or keep the volume low, and please keep your voices down. Be considerate of other guests in the dorm/hotel.

Utilities and use:

  • Heating and air conditioning should be used sparingly. NEVER leave heating or air conditioning units while you are not in the room. If you must have them on when you are sleeping, keep them low.
  • Always turn off the lights when you are not in the room.

Safety:

  • You should lock your door at all times. Also, when leaving the hotel, make sure your windows are closed and locked. Neither the study abroad company nor the dorm/hotel will not be responsible for any stolen items.
  • It is strictly forbidden to throw any object or substance from windows, balconies, terraces or roofs. This includes keys, cigarette butts or anything else big or small.

Guests and Alcohol Policies:

  • Smoking is not allowed anywhere inside the dorm/hotel.
  • The consumption of drugs, as well as keeping or dealing with them, is absolutely prohibited

Financial Liability:

  • You will have to pay for any damage done to the room (doors, walls, floors, furniture, etc.).
